Why Chinese Is a Struggle for Many PSLE Students

For many Singaporean families, especially those where English is the primary spoken language at home, Chinese becomes a second or even third language. Despite being a mother tongue, many children find themselves lagging behind in vocabulary, comprehension, or composition writing.

The PSLE Chinese paper is not just about basic conversation skills. It tests a child’s ability to read fluently, understand passages, answer comprehension questions effectively, and write compositions with proper structure and a rich vocabulary. For a 12-year-old, this can be overwhelming without the right support system in place.

Tips for Parents: Supporting Your Child’s Chinese Learning Journey

Even with tuition, parental support plays a crucial role. Here’s how you can help:

  • Create a Language-Friendly Environment at Home
    Encourage your child to read Chinese storybooks, watch Chinese programmes, or even label household items in Chinese. Immersion helps with retention.
  • Speak the Language Together
    Practice simple conversations in Chinese during daily routines. It could be as easy as ordering food or talking about their day.
  • Celebrate Small Wins
    Acknowledge every bit of progress, whether it’s an improved test score or mastering a new idiom. Encouragement goes a long way.
